Pro-Mist filters still continue to give today’s cinematographer, using modern cameras, a beautiful and effective look. Offering a timeless glow, along with its darker version, black pro mist, remains in the minds of many cinematographers as the de facto fusion reference. When one comes to considering adding diffusion to an image, the pro mist range of filters is as at home on film as well as digital cameras. It’s halation is more prominent than pearlescent, which is easily seen in the practical and specular light sources.

In the stronger densities it is clearly apparent how the Pro-Mist diffuse effect reduces the skin tone shimmer, clearly diluting both skin tone values. Hi Just wondering if any users have had any experience using the Hollywood Black Magic diffusion filters made by Schneider? I currently use a Softar I filter to take the edge off of my digital photos, but I like the look of the Hollywood Black Magic diffusers which combines both a schneider soft and black frost effect. I'm also looking for something slightly more subtle than the Softar filter (even at it's I grade!) I'm wondering if any users have tried the Hollywood Black Magic filters, and if so which strength they would recommend with these requirements in mind. I've only been able to find examples online of them being used in videos thus far, and not yet found a UK hire outlet that offers screw in versions of the filters for rental to try out, so any user input is super handy! PS I know these effects can be added in post but I have a general preference for getting the image as close to how I want in camera when and where possible!

Black Diffusion/FX, is a distinctive yet simple diffusion filter, as it is refined in its ability to reduce fine sharp detail and produce a minimal effect on bounced and reduced highlights. The Black Diffusion/FX look, is apparent by its seemingly non-destructive effect, meaning that any reduction in color saturation is kept to a minimum. When used on close ups, facial features, such as eyes and hair remain sharp on the focal plane while finer and unwanted skin detail smoothly blends away.
